A instrument used to find out the calcium carbonate saturation stage of water, this digital or analog useful resource helps keep balanced pool chemistry. It takes under consideration elements like pH, temperature, calcium hardness, complete alkalinity, and complete dissolved solids to calculate a single worth. A balanced saturation index signifies water that’s neither corrosive nor scale-forming.
Sustaining correct water stability is crucial for the longevity of pool gear and surfaces. A balanced index prevents points resembling etching of plaster, corrosion of metallic parts, and the unpleasant buildup of calcium scale. Traditionally, reaching this stability relied on guide calculations and changes. Trendy instruments streamline this course of, offering correct readings and proposals for changes, finally saving time and sources.
